Anna Auza/Unsplash Lazada Malaysia’s SME stimulus package returns as Pakej Kedai Pintar 2.0 with a quadrupled funding of RM44 million to help over 70,000 local small-and-med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in staying afloat throughout the second Movement Control Order (MCO). Businesses can sign up for the stimulus package from now until 28 February 2021 at http://lzd.co/SellOnLazadaMY New and current participating sellers under the Pakej Kedai Pintar 2.0 stimulus package will enjoy 0% commission rates, waived payment fees, 90 days of dedicated store-building support, Lazada University training, subsidised advertising credits for Sponsored Search, free product exposure slots on Lazada Flash Sale, and more*. “With more than one in three Malaysians shopping on the Lazada app every month, we are able to leverage our strong consumer base to help local SMEs ‘MCO-proof’ their business, and in the meantime, enable them to retain job stability for their employees. After we launched the first Pakej Kedai Pintar stimulus package during MCO last year, local SMEs on our platform generated more than double the sales. The impact of the initiative also goes beyond just short-term digital adoption, but also for long-term sustainability and growth as we drive the end-to-end digital transformation of entrepreneurs – from upskilling them in store building and customer engagement, to providing a unique access of real-time behavioural data, and ultimately boosting conversion,” said Sherry Tan, Chief Business Officer, Lazada Malaysia.
